Both Bentley and Williams are private. Both schools are located in Massachusetts.
  • Williams Graduate School has more expensive graduate school tuition of $64,540 than Bentley Graduate School ($44,720).
  • Bentley Graduate School is larger with 1,034 graduate students than Williams Graduate School (53 students).
  • Bentley Graduate School has more graduate programs of 60 programs than Williams Graduate School (40 programs).
